COAST - RBSA Gallery


Work exhibiting at Coast is inspired by a collection of experiences from a childhood in the Isle of Man and holidays further afield.  Pattern, colour and textures found in seascapes are re-appropriated using new technologies and materials, alongside more familiar silversmithing methods.  A colour pallet of intense pink, muted greens and blues through to monochrome is inspired by stones, plant and marine life discovered next to and beyond the waters edge.

RBSA Gallery (Coast), Samples & Research

I'm working on a collection of pieces for an upcoming exhibition at the RBSA Gallery, Birmingham - Coast.  This is also complementing my Manchester Craft & Design Centre project, as I have been looking at more ironwork and architectural features, moving on to piers, jetties and Victorian seafronts.

The resin fishing net design above came about after a weekend in Hastings back in January 2009 when I was there on an enameling course.  Last week I had a look through some old images of samples I made from then (part of my final college project), which I thought might sit nicely with research I was doing for Coast.

I knitted and crocheted silver and copper wire to enamel - domes and decorative shapes inspired by old ironwork.  Below is an assortment of photographs showing a few of these samples, (some of these were later made into stones and incorporated into jewellery).

On the Sunday morning in Hastings, I had a few hours free time and took myself down to the seafront to take pictures of coastal features which I could initially interpret using wire to use for enameling.  I now plan to revisit this work and develop it further.
